Tips For Homeowners on Septic System Health in Union, OR.

As we are all aware, every dwelling is complete without a waste tank. As responsible homeowners, it is imperative to show great care to keeping up of your sewage system's well-being, since it directly affects not only your health but also the environment.

Visualize the hassle of waking up early in the morning and realizing that your toilet is clogged, or having to endure the unpleasant odor emanating from a septic tank leak.

Below are some simple procedures for householders to comply with to maintain maintain the condition of their sewage system.

Regular Inspection and Pumping

Typically, a home septic tank should be professionally examined at least every 3-5 years by skilled professionals. During this inspection, the professional examiners can check for seepage, inspect both the upper and lower sections of your tank, analyze the accumulated scum and sludge in your sewage tank, and perform skilled pumping of your tank.

Efficient Use Of Water

Minimizing water usage in a home results in less water going into the sewage system. Toilet flushing habits accounts for approximately 25-30% of water use in the residential property. An optimal method to reduce water utilization in the restroom involves replacing older models with high-efficiency fixtures, which use fewer gallons of water for each flush.

High Efficiency Shower Heads

The water utilized when showering is also directed into the sewage system. To decrease this, a prudent step is to utilize high-efficiency shower appliances, crafted to decrease water use.

Proper Disposal of Waste

Numerous folks exhibit the unfortunate practice of treating the bathroom as if it were a waste receptacle. However, practicing this conduct ultimately results in sewage system clogs. Therefore, householders must ensure that everyone in the household gets rid of refuse appropriately and doesn't flush it down the toilet.

Types Of Septic Tank Systems Available

When septic tank installation, skilled technicians take multiple factors into account, including which include the scale of the structure, local weather conditions, climatic conditions of the location, soil type, and so forth.

All of these aspects play a role in choosing the right variety of septic tank system to be. Here are the various types of sewage tank systems ready for installation at DJ Plumbing Septic Tank Services:

Conventional Tank System

Commonly described as a gravity-based sewage system, this kind of septic system is the most widely used and the simplest to set up and keep in good condition. This particular septic tank system doesn't demand any extra complex electrical or technological elements. Instead, it relies exclusively on natural forces, specifically gravity.

Chamber Septic Tank System

Commonly known as the pressure distribution septic system, features drain chambers typically constructed from high-density polyethylene plastic. Nevertheless, it's worth noting that different materials can be utilized for these chambers.

During the previous 30-year period, this particular type of septic tank system has gained considerable recognition, largely because of its economical installation and straightforward setup. Caring for it is akin to a similar process to the conventional a standard septic tank system.

Mound Septic Tank System

This septic tank system is employed for buildings positioned on thin soil or in close proximity to surface rock formations. The installation of this tank system involves creating a man-made mound consisting of distinct levels of soil, gravel, and sand as the drainfield.

As opposed to the traditional septic tank system, this type of septic tank system utilizes electrical energy, as well as demands periodic maintenance and examinations, unlike the standard septic tank system, which happens to be substantially easier to maintain.

Aerobic Treatment Unit

Also known as ATU or Aerobic Treatment Unit, this type of septic tank system utilizes an electric pump for pumping oxygen into the septic tank. The presence of oxygen enables aerobic microbes to prosper within the septic tank. This process causes the biodegradation of waste materials contained within the septic tank.

Usually, such septic tank is usually built in locations adjacent to surface aquatic environments or where there are hostile soil conditions. It should be emphasized that caring for such septic tank system can be quite expensive, because it demands continuous maintenance treatments.

Recirculating Sand Filter Septic Tank System

This septic tank system utilizes sand filtration to process and redistribute of wastewater. To function effectively, this system requires the installation of electricity. When compared to various sewage tanks, the installation and maintenance of this system tends to be on the pricier side.

Union is a city in Union County, Oregon, United States, originally platted in 1864, and located 15 miles (24 km) southeast of La Grande. It is the namesake of Union County, which references the Union states, or Northern States, of the American Civil War. The population was 2,152 at the 2020 census. The city is known for the numerous historic Victorian homes that line its Main Street, some of which are registered on the National Register of Historic Places. It is also home to Oregon State University's Eastern Oregon Agricultural Research Center, founded in 1888, which is contemporarily housed in the former Union train station.
